SVLG markets itself on deep technical fluency — a firm built specifically to serve Silicon Valley technology companies, with a full practice area dedicated to information security. That makes a broken piece of their own homepage a harder thing to wave off.
The "Latest from the Blog" section renders empty
The homepage includes a dedicated section pulling in the firm's most recent blog post. Instead of a title and link, the live markup shows an empty anchor tag with no href and no text — a blank line where a real post preview should be:
<a href=""></a>
The "View More" link directly beneath it still works and goes to
blog.svlg.com, so this isn't a dead blog — it's specifically the
auto-pulled preview snippet that's failing to populate. For a firm whose blog is a
stated part of their content and SEO strategy, the one spot on the homepage built to
showcase it is currently showing nothing.
Findings verified against live page source on the audit date above. Site platform: Justia Elevate.
